How We Ranked These Sites for Value
We focused on three main criteria. First, the exchange rate for loyalty points. Second, the variety of items in the VIP shop. Third, the wagering requirements attached to any bonus you buy with points. A high point-earning rate means nothing if the shop is empty or the terms are punishing.
- Point Accumulation Speed: How many points per $10 wagered? Some sites give 1 point per $20, others give 1 per $10.
- Shop Item Variety: Cash, free spins, bonus credits, physical goods. The best shops have multiple options.
- Wagering on Point-Bought Bonuses: This is the hidden tax. A 30x wagering requirement on a points-bought bonus is standard. Anything above 40x starts to feel like a grind.
- Withdrawal Speed for Cash Rewards: If you cash out points for real money, how fast does it hit your wallet?
We also checked whether the points expire. Some sites wipe your balance after 90 days of inactivity. That is a dealbreaker for casual punters.

Are the Points Actually Worth Anything?
This is the million-dollar question. In our testing, we found that points are worth something, but the value depends entirely on the exchange rate and the wagering requirements. A site that gives you 1 point per $10 wagered but requires 40x play on the bonus is effectively giving you a small percentage back. A site with 1 point per $20 wagered but 30x play might actually be better.
We did the math on a few scenarios. For a player who wagers $1000 per month, the difference between a 30x and 40x wagering requirement on points-bought bonuses can be tens of dollars in expected value. That is not nothing. Over a year, it adds up to a few hundred bucks.
Some shops offer cashback with no wagering. That is the benchmark. If you see a site offering cashback for points with no playthrough, grab it. Those are rare and valuable.

Three Things to Watch Out For
- Point Expiry Dates: Some sites wipe your points after 90 days. Others keep them as long as you log in once a month. Check the terms.
- Wagering on Points-Bought Bonuses: Always check the wagering requirement before you redeem. A 40x requirement is common, but 30x is better.
- Minimum Redemption Thresholds: Some shops require you to accumulate a certain number of points before you can cash out. A high threshold makes the points feel worthless.
These three factors can make or break a loyalty program. A generous point rate means nothing if you cannot redeem them easily.
